Literary Chronicles by Craig A. Best, published by Xlibris Corporation LLC in September 2010, is a collection of inspirational poetry that invites readers to reflect on their own experiences and thoughts. This edition comprises 70 pages and is presented in English, offering a journey through a 13-year span of life’s moments, both good and bad, as seen through the lens of the author’s worldly views.
Readers will find a blend of poetry and songs that encourage deep contemplation and connection with the themes presented. The work focuses on the interplay of personal experiences and broader societal observations, making it suitable for those interested in poetry that explores inspirational and religious subjects. Whether enjoyed in one sitting or over time, Literary Chronicles aims to resonate with readers on multiple levels, providing a space for reflection and connection.
